One of the pioneers in this field is the Norwegian company, Equinor, which has developed a revolutionary new design for floating wind turbines. The Hywind Tampen project, located off the coast of Norway, is the world’s first commercial-scale floating wind farm, with seven 8-megawatt turbines capable of meeting the power needs of 60,000 homes. The project’s success has paved the way for similar developments around the world, from the UK to Japan and the US.

But the benefits of offshore wind technology go far beyond just meeting our energy needs. By harnessing the power of the oceans, we can also help to mitigate the impacts of climate change. The International Renewable Energy Agency (IRENA) estimates that if we were to deploy just 2% of the world’s oceans with wind farms, we could reduce global greenhouse gas emissions by up to 280 million tons per year.

Of course, there are still challenges to overcome before we can unlock the full potential of offshore wind technology. The cost of building and maintaining these massive turbines is still a major hurdle, and the need for specialized vessels and equipment adds to the expense. But as the technology continues to evolve, the costs are coming down, and the benefits are becoming clearer.
